--- linux-2.4.0-ac4/drivers/scsi/advansys.c Mon Jan 8 20:39:28 2001
+++ linux-2.4.0-ac4.acme/drivers/scsi/advansys.c Tue Jan 9 00:12:03 2001
@@ -717,6 +717,13 @@
Ken Mort <ken@mort.net> reported a DEBUG compile bug fixed
in 3.2K.
+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o <acme@conectiva.com.br> fix issues
+ related to save_flags/restore_flags, some restore_flags and
+ DvcLeaveCritical were missing, use unsigned long flags instead
+ of int flags, a not needed cli commented out, like the sti
+ that matches it (in advansys_abort) - 08/01/2001
+
+
